The Bible contains some wonderful stories about people who began to serve God when they were children. We’ve heard a lot about David and the rocks, Samuel and the Voice of God, Joseph and his coat; but the story of Josiah, the boy king, is not familiar to many of us, even though it appears twice in Scripture – in 2 Kings and 2 Chronicles.
Josiah became the king of Judah when he was eight years old and reigned for thirty-one years. Scripture doesn’t fill in the details about the first few years of Josiah’s reign, but the fact that Scripture does reveal certainly kindles the imagination!
